LiDAR (Light Detection and Ranging) is a powerful tool for geologists, enabling detailed mapping of structural geology in areas of outcrop and identifying local workings. This technology provides high-resolution data that is invaluable for geological surveys and mineral exploration.
LiDAR technology uses laser pulses to measure distances to the Earth’s surface, generating high-resolution topographic maps. These maps provide critical information about the terrain, including subtle variations that can signal the presence of mineral deposits. By identifying features such as fault lines, fractures, and other geological structures, LiDAR helps geologists target areas with high mineral potential.
